Back on January 13th, 2006, according to Democracy Now, we learn that Iran threatened to halt snap inspections of its nuclear sites by the United Nations if its nuclear program is referred to the Security Council.
Senator John Kerry (D-MA) said, “Ultimately if we are not able to find any diplomatic resolution in the next weeks I don’t think we have any choice but to take it to the international community. I think Iran has made a very dangerous and a very silly decision and it is inviting confrontation not with the United States but with the global community that cares enormously about the control of nuclear weapons.” |
On January 28th, 2007, according to the Fars News Agency, we learn that, while addressing a world Economic Forum meeting in Davos Switzerland on Saturday, this same Senator John Kerry strongly rejected West’s demanded prerequisites for the resumption of nuclear talks with Iran.
“We should give up pessimism and pick up a realistic view,” he said. |
